

Low temperature drying is a process that is used in many different industries, particularly the food industry. This process is used to reduce the moisture content of food products, allowing them to be stored for longer and to improve their shelf life. Low temperature drying is also beneficial for the production of pet feed and animal feed, as it preserves the nutritional content of these products.
Dryers are the machines used to carry out the low temperature drying process. The most common dryers used in the food industry are hot air dryers, which use hot air to reduce the moisture content of the product.
